Samsung's 2014 flagship, the Galaxy S5, has already seen several variants in the form of the Galaxy S5 mini, Galaxy S5 Plus, Galaxy S5 Sport, and Galaxy S5 Active among others. Now, the company has quietly introduced a new model dubbed Galaxy S5 New Edition (aka Samsung Galaxy S5 Neo) in Brazil. The smartphone is now listed on the Samsung's Brazil website without any pricing or availability details.

Notably, the listing of the Samsung Galaxy S5 New Edition is just the first time the Samsung Galaxy S5 Neo, which was listed by a Dutch online retailer in July, has been officially introduced. The smartphones boast of identical specifications.

Much like the Galaxy S5, the Galaxy S5 New Edition packs a heart rate sensor placed near the 16-megapixel camera, and the IP67 certification that makes it dust and water-resistant. The smartphone also features a back panel with perforated design, already seen on the Galaxy S5.

For innards, the Galaxy S5 New Edition runs Android 5.1 Lollipop and features a 5.1-inch Super Amoled display with a 1080x1920 pixel full-HD resolution. It is powered by an octa-core processor clocked at 1.6GHz with 2GB of RAM and will be available in 16GB inbuilt storage with microSD card expandability up to 128GB. The Galaxy S5 New Edition sports a 16-megapixel rear camera with HDR (for video as well), and a 5-megapixel front-facing camera.

Connectivity options include 4G LTE, Wi-Fi 802.11 a/b/g/n/ac with MIMO functionality, ANT+, Bluetooth 4.0, USB3.0, NFC, and infrared remote functionality. The dual-SIM based smartphone packs a 2800mAh battery. The smartphone weighs in at 145 grams, and has dimensions of 142x72.5x8.1mm. The handset will be compatible with the company's wearables such as the Gear Fit.
